XP POWER XPP DC-DC Converter - 3W 4:1

Introducing the XP POWER XPP series DC-DC converter, designed for reliable power conversion in compact electronic applications. With a power rating of 3W and a 4:1 input voltage ratio, this module offers efficient and stable performance suitable for various industrial and electronic systems.
